T-6 Jedi Shuttle (#7931)

Another great deal on Bricklink, less than half the shelf price because the minifigures weren't included. That's okay, I have extra Jedi just sitting around not doing anything. And while the Shaak Ti and Saesee Tiin minifigs are pretty cool and new to this set, Obiwan hasn't been in very many sets in the past, but another Anakin figure?? Good grief, he seems to be a standard filler in most of the sets.

Anyhow, this is another installment in the Clone Wars line. This one has a really good "swoosh factor" and was a fairly straight-forward build. It came in right before I was heading out of town for a few days so I actually put it together in my hotel room.

Here's the front view. I was very happy to see the canopy was printed as opposed to needing stickers. I also like how they used the white arch pieces for the engine housing on the back.

The profile view. There is a folding landing gear on the bottom which is surprisingly stable.

The cockpit is designed to serve as an escape pod and seats two Jedi (so long as they don't have their lightsabers in-hand). Mace Windu is riding shot-gun with Kit Fisto, but will most likely give up his seat to Aayla Secura once I open my Clone Turbo Tank.

Here are the wings in flight mode. The small gear wheel on the bottom does a great job of keeping the wings from flopping around while in flight. There are two flick-fire missiles which are fired when you pull back on the engine pods on the back. However, I thought this was annoying, so I secured the pods so they don't move and I don't have to go searching for the flick-fire missiles.

This one kept me entertained for the evenings I spent alone in the hotel room, although I'd recommend closing the curtains before you start flying around the room with your shuttle unless you want weird looks from people walking outside.
